News ≫ Australian Government to provide humanitarian assistance to Sri Lanka.

Today Hon Julie Bishop, Minister for Foreign Affairs announced that the Australian Government will provide $500,000 as humanitarian assistance to the people of Sri Lanka affected by devastating heavy rain, flash flooding and landslides.

The assistance will support the deployment of inflatable boats and outboard motors to contribute to search and rescue efforts, the delivery of clean water, the establishment of safe spaces for children, and the provision of vital health services to affected women and girls. The Australian Government commended the Sri Lankan authorities and the United Nations for their effective response to this emergency. They also informed that they will continue to monitor the situation and stand ready to provide further assistance as required.
